Lahad Datu airport (Lahad Datu)

Country: Malaysia

ISO country code: MY

City: Lahad Datu

Airport name: Lahad Datu

IATA code: LDU

ICAO code: WBKD

Time zone: -8.0 GMT

Height above sea level: 14 meters

The length of the runway: 1372 meters

LDU airport Lahad Datu transcript or LDU which airport?

The name of the airport: Lahad Datu. The airport is located in the country: Malaysia. The city location of the airport in Lahad Datu. IATA airport code Lahad Datu: LDU. The IATA airport code is a 3 letter unique identifier, assigned airports world International air transport Association (IATA). ICAO airport code Lahad Datu: WBKD. The ICAO airport code is a 4 letter unique identifier that is assigned to the airports by the International civil aviation organization (ICAO).

The geographic coordinates of the airport Lahad Datu.

The latitude at which the airport is located: 5.032247000000, the longitude of airport: 118.324036000000. Geographic coordinates of latitude and longitude define the position of the airport on the earth's surface. To fully define the position of the airport in three-dimensional space, we should also know the third coordinate is the height. The height of the airport above sea level is 14 meters. The airport is located in the time zone: -8.0 GMT. The airline always indicates local time of departure and arrival airport according to the time zones.
